Retail and Product Packaging
A branded carton sells the product at point of sale when no one from your team is available to describe it.
Reverse tuck end boxes are suitable for lighter retail goods such as cosmetics, supplements and beauty products, while a crash lock base provides heavier items with a floor that will not give way in transit.
Both prints across each panel, including the inside, so the branding stays in view no matter how the box ends up placed on a shelf or in a stockroom.

Gift and Showcase Boxes
Bespoke gift boxes are important.
A solid box with an convenient closure, metallic stamping on the lid, or a velvety coating influences how a product feels before it is even opened.
It is specifically the point for jewellery, perfume, and boutique food brands, in which the packaging makes up part of what the customer has bought.
Foil stamping is the treatment that does the best job on a shelf, catching the light in a way flat print never can, while soft-touch coating works more effectively once the box is actually in a person’s hands, as it feels high-end the moment they pick up it.
Raised print sits between the two, positioning a logo you can both see and touch, and it works especially well on jewellery and perfume boxes, where the surface itself becomes part of the display.
Sleeves and wallets
Not every brand project requires a complete box rebuild.
A branded sleeve fits over an existing tray or product, including your branding without the need to rework the entire pack, which makes this ideal for a limited promotional run or a time-limited variant.
A wallet-style box folds tidily around flatter products such as cards or cosmetics sets, while labelled inserts help stop loose items moving inside a more spacious box during transit.

Sustainably Procured, Eco-friendly Materials
Every container we create is 100% recyclable and produced from board carrying FSC and PEFC certification. This indicates it can be traced back through an audited supply chain to a responsibly managed forest.
We are shifting away from single-use plastic and EPS foam across the range, replacing them with paper and biodegradable and biodegradable alternatives wherever the format allows. These materials decompose appropriately at the end of their life in a way plastic and foam materials not.
